中文摘要:目的:寻找国产紫苏新的化学型。方法:采用气味排除法,从800份紫苏种质中选出非PK化学型的种质,取叶片用水蒸气蒸馏法提取紫苏叶挥发油,经GC-MS对其化学成分进行分离和鉴定。结果:初筛获得62份非PK型紫苏种质,鉴定出3种新的单一成分构成化学型或亚型,包括1份PA-Ⅱ型种质,以高含量的D-柠檬烯为特点;3份PT-Ⅱ型种质,具有高含量(-)-胡椒酮,而不含有胡椒烯酮;2份PS型种质,以倍半萜成分为主,有以石竹烯氧化物为主的PS-c型和以(Z,E)α-法尼烯为主的PS-f型;混合化学型中,PAPK型3份,另有6种新混合型,包括PAPT型1份、PAPP型1份、PKPP型1份、PAPS型2份和PPPS型1份。结论:本研究丰富了紫苏属挥发油的化学型类型,为紫苏的研究和利用提供了珍贵的材料。

GC-MS Analysis of Volatile Oil from 62 Non-PK Perilla Germplasms and Discovery of New Chemotypes
Abstract:Objective:To search for new chemotypes of Perilla frutescens in China.Methods:Non-PK type’s germplasms were selected from 800 perilla germplasms by odor exclusion method,and the volatile oils from perilla leaves were extracted by steam distillation,and their chemical constituents were isolated and identified by GC-MS.Results:62 germplasms of non-PK perilla were obtained and three of them were identified as new single-component chemotypes or subtypes,such as 1 PA-Ⅱ germplasm with high content of D-limonene;3 PT-Ⅱ germplasms with high content of (-)-piperitone,but no piperitenone;2 PS germplasms mainly contained sesquiterpenes,PS-c type dominated by caryophyllene oxide and PS-f type dominated by(Z,E)-α-farnesene.Among the mixed chemotypes,there were 3 PAPK types and 6 new mixed types,including 1 PAPT type,1 PAPP type,1 PKPP type,2 PAPS types and 1 PPPS type.Conclusion:This study enriches the chemotypes of volatile oils of perilla and provides valuable materials for the research and utilization of perilla.
